Web15 feb. 2024 · In fact, giving an actual newline (can be obtained with $'\n' in bash) would work with tr (e.g. tr " " $'\n' works) but not with sed (e.g. sed $'s/ /\n/g' does not work) – YoungFrog Jul 14, 2024 at 12:58 1 @YoungFrog sed $'s/ /\\n/g'. A literal newline has to be escaped with a backslash. But sed 'y/ /\n/' would be faster and also more portable. Method 2: Using the “set -v” Command. The “v” is another useful option of the “set” utility to print the input shell commands as they are executed/read.It does not print any special character or symbol before each line of the script as the “set -x” command.
